question 17\nthe net shown below can be used to form a solid. which solid can be formed?\nimage of a net\na) ○ pentagonal prism\nb) ○ rectangular pyramid\nc) ○ triangular prism\nd) ○ triangular pyramid\ne) ○ rectangular prism
Answer
Brief Explanations:
A triangular prism's net consists of two triangular bases and three rectangular faces. The given net has two triangular faces (the ones with the right - angle and the other triangle) and three rectangular faces. A pentagonal prism would have a pentagonal base, a rectangular pyramid has a rectangular base and triangular lateral faces, a triangular pyramid (tetrahedron) has four triangular faces, and a rectangular prism has six rectangular faces (or two square and four rectangular in case of a cube - like rectangular prism). So the net forms a triangular prism.
Answer:
c) triangular prism
